Finance Minister, Iranian Ambassador Discuss Economic Cooperation

DAMASCUS, (ST) – The Minister of Finance Dr. Mamoun Hamdan and the ambassador of the Islamic Republic of Iran in Damascus Jawad Turkabadi discussed here on Sunday ways of enhancing cooperation between the two friendly countries in the financial and economic fields.

Mr. Hamdan reviewed the efforts exerted by the government to modernize investment laws and simplify procedures, especially in the industrial fields. He called on Iranian businessmen to invest in Syria in the reconstruction phase, noting the great role played by the Iranian companies.

 On his part, the Iranian ambassador confirmed the depth of the historical relations between Iran and Syria, pointing out that the strength of the two friendly countries is represented in standing side by side to defend the right. He also hailed the victories achieved by the Syrian army.

He pointed out that many of the agreements between the two countries are going on the right track based on the solid ground prepared over the years to be the best work, stressing the need to develop strategies for the next phase through the revitalization of investments between the two countries.
